Jasprit Bumrah and Marco Jansen had an angry confrontation in the middle, which could have been made worse if Judge Marais Erasmus had not intervened quickly to calm the tension.
The incident happened when Jansen bounced and Bumrah, when he tried to hook up, was unable to connect properly and the ball went to the point.
And Jansen, turning to the Indian captain, let out a torrent of words.

This angered Bumrah, who charged against Jansen. The two met in the middle of the field, and the situation looked bad.
Merit for quick access to Erasmus.
It was the moment when a tight and tense match weakened the minds.
Later, when Bumrah hit Kagiso Rabada at six, the Indian locker room cheers were the loudest.
